Ive noticed that CCleaner cleans only the C-Drive. Can anyone help me by telling me hoe to use the CCleaner to clean other drives

Well CC only cleans the operating system drive because thats were all the main programs and web browser(s) run from. If you know the folder names on the other drives that you want cleaning then goto Options\Include and click on Add Folder or Add File so they can be cleaned at the same time. When you add a folder and there are specfic files in that folder you want to delete then filebox at the bottom will say *.* just change that to *.tmp or what ever.

Be very careful what you add to these folders else you could be deleting files that you need in which case you would need to run Recuva to retrieve them back. ;)
